3 credits This course combines A common reading and discussion agenda with ongoing work on an individual senior project. Students will read critical pieces representing the range of different theoretical approaches to the study of literature and see how these explicate and illuminate the reading done in common. Prerequisite: 6 credits of 3000-level CLITR courses OR permission of the instructor.
